Title
Commending and honoring SEPTA Police Officer Ronald P. Jones for his heroic acts of duty and bravery in the apprehension of a violent assailant threatening to shoot innocent passengers on the train at the Fairmount Station.
 
Body
Whereas, Officer Ronald P. Jones is 44 years old, married and has one daughter.  He is a five year veteran of the Police Department, presently assigned to Operation Bureau, Uniform Patrol District  No. 6 which fulfills public and operational safety obligations for SEPTA between City Hall Station and North Philadelphia Station  at Broad and Glenwood Avenue; and 
 
Whereas, On Monday, March 17, 2014 at approximately 2:55 p.m., Officer Jones responded to a police radio call of a man with a gun threatening passengers onboard a southbound Broad Street Line train that just left Cecil B. Moore Station; and
 
Whereas, Officer Jones informed police radio that he would inspect the next southbound train at Fairmount Station. When the train arrived, Officer Jones immediately observed a man screaming at a female passenger, threatening to shoot her; and  
 
Whereas, Officer Jones ordered the man off the train before the assailant viciously attacked him. Officer Jones defended himself from the assault, first with the use of OC spray (pepper spray) which had no effect, and then with his expandable baton as the man screamed shoot me; and
 
Whereas, During the struggle the officer fell to the ground with the assailant trying to rip the handgun from Officer Jones' holster. The vicious attack continued for several minutes until backup Officers arrived to assist Officer Jones and place the man under arrest and;
 
Whereas, Officer Ronald Jones' swift response, tactical approach and tremendous professional restraint in confronting this violent offender was critical in protecting dozens of SEPTA passengers and prevented a further escalation of the incident by a very dangerous assailant; and
 
Whereas, Officer Ronald Jones' actions demonstrate his professional commitment and personal character in fulfilling his public safety duties. The City of Philadelphia and the entire SEPTA Transit Authority commends the officer for this outstanding and heroic public service; and now therefore   
 
BE IT RESOLVED, BY TH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F PHILADELPHIA, that it hereby commends and honors SEPTA Police Officer Ronald P. Jones for is heroic acts of duty and bravery in the apprehension of a violent assailant threatening to shoot innocent passengers on a SEPTA train; and
 
FURTHER RESOLVED, that an Engrossed copy of this Resolution be presented to Officer Ronald P. Jones as evidence of the sincere appreciation of this legislative body.
